REFLECTOR REMOVAL AS A MEANS OF PILE CONTROL

The effect on reactivity of removing an all-over reflector from a square cylinder reactor is discussed, and a means of estimating the effect of removing a portion, e.g. the ends, is provided. By removing an all-over refiector from a reactor, it is possible to obtain up to about 50% change in reactivity, this upper limit being in fast piles. The available control increases also with the thickness of the reflector, but not much is gained for thickness of more than 6 or 8 inches. It was concluded from the resuits obtained that adequate control could be achieved in fast and intermediate reactors with a not unreasonable distortion of the reflector. (auth)
